Mobile App DevelopmentTrending Apps

How to Develop a Video Streaming App Like HBOmax?

how-to-develop-a-video-streaming-app-like-hbomax

Quick Summary: This blog is a comprehensive guide on how to build a video streaming app like HBO Max. Before explaining the step-by-step process of video streaming app development, we have provided detailed information on the benefits, market statistics, reasons behind their popularity, features to add, and much more. 

Video streamlining apps like HBO Max have become immensely popular over the past few years. In 2024, it had over 48.6 million active and paid subscribers and approximately 12.4 million HBO Max app downloads worldwide. 

These numbers give us all a clear picture of the potential of video streaming apps and OTT platforms and the growing interest of users towards them. Since platforms like HBO Max (now, Max) have a strong market reputation and humongous user base, many might hesitate to invest in a video streaming app development. 

However, if you follow a structured and well-defined process to develop a video streaming platform like HBO Max, your platform may give the existing on-demand streaming apps or platforms a run for their money. 

This comprehensive guide to building a video streaming platform similar to HBO Max can help you with that. Let’s quickly begin. 

What is HBO Max

Now known as Max, HBO Max is an online streaming platform that enables users to watch movies, TV shows, and other entertainment content from the device of their choice. It is a large library of entertainment with TV shows from HBO, movies from Warner Bros, and other video content from Discovery. 

Having HBO Max on your phone means direct access to all the popular and legendary TV shows like Friends, The Lord of the Rings, Game of Thrones, and many others. 

Market Statistics to Know Before You Develop a Video Streaming Platform Like HBO Max

We have already provided you with two most interesting stats related to the on-demand video streaming app HBO Max. Now, let’s explore some more:

  • HBO Max generated approximately $60 million in July 2024.
  • Max, HBO, HBO Max, and Discovery+ together had over 103 million subscribers in Q2, 2024.
  • The worldwide revenue of SVOD (Subscription Video On-Demand) is projected to reach 137.7 billion U.S. dollars by 2027.
  • The worldwide revenue of AVOD (Ad-supported Video On-Demand) is anticipated to reach 63.5 billion U.S. dollars by 2027.

What does a Video Streaming App like HBO Max do

Before you build a video streaming platform like HBO Max or Max, let’s understand the working of such a platform. Basically, Max offers users on-demand access to a vast library of video content. Here is what it does:

  • It provides users with access to explore and access different types of content, including movies, TV shows, web series, documentaries, and other original productions. 
  • Max offers content from HBO, Warner Bros, DC, and Discovery.
  • Users can access apps like HBO Max on different devices and platforms, like smartphones, tablets, smart TVs, and computer systems.
  • Apps like HBO Max have a wide range of audiences from different age groups. Therefore, it offers diverse content, fulfilling the needs of different users.
  • HBO Max follows a subscription model that allows users to access premium content by subscribing to different plans. 

HBO Max-Like Video Streaming App Development: Step-by-Step Process

For the successful development of your HBO Max-like app, follow these steps:

steps-to-develop-a-video-streaming-app-like-hbomax

Step #1: Market Research and Planning 

The first step is to analyze the competition, i.e., thoroughly understand what HBO Max, Netflix, and other streaming applications offer. Figure out where they lack and what their USPs are. 

Now, decide your target audience considering factors such as demographics, viewing habits, and more. Select a specific genre or region you want to focus on. Make a structured plan for content licensing and acquisitions. 

Besides, prepare a list of the core and advanced features that will make your app stand out from the competition. You can choose features like video playback, content library, personalized user profiles, multiple payment gateways, search and filters, and others. 

Based on your research, prepare a development roadmap that will determine your custom video streaming app development time and budget. This step also includes deciding on the right technology stack for your app. Choose the right technology stack, i.e., front-end and back-end frameworks, databases, video streaming networks and services, and payment gateways integration. 

Step #2: App Design

The next crucial step is to design UI/UX for your video streaming app like HBO Max. Create a user-friendly design that focuses on innovativeness, visual appeal, and seamless navigation for content discovery. Develop wireframes to get an idea of the app’s structure and functionality. You can also build prototypes to verify the user flow and potential design-related issues at an early stage. 

Step #3: HBO Max-Like App Development 

Follow an agile methodology to develop a video streaming app like HBO Max. Build robust APIs to establish seamless communication between the front-end and back-end. Choose the right tech stack to begin the development process. An HBO Max-like video streaming app development needs to be successfully and flawlessly run on multiple platforms and devices; therefore, don’t forget to ensure the same. 

Step #4: Testing 

Run performance, functional, usability, and security testing to ensure your app is bug-free. Also, run user acceptance tests (UAT) by allowing real users to test the app and give their feedback. Make amendments based on the feedback. Focus on the app’s security to prevent data-related issues and content piracy. 

Step #5: Launch 

Launch the app on the Apple App Store and the Google Play Store by adhering to each platform’s submission guidelines. Also, deploy your back-end infrastructure to a cloud platform for seamless content accessibility to all users. 

Step #6:  Monitoring and Maintenance 

Once you successfully submit or deploy your video streaming application, the next step is to continuously monitor its performance, keep it updated with the latest features and content, and identify and troubleshoot bugs right when they occur and before they impact user experience.  

Similar Read: OTT Platform Development: A Comprehensive Guide in 2025

For the continuous success and enhanced user experience of your on-demand video streaming app like HBO Max, don’t forget to offer round-the-clock customer support services. This would help users resolve their queries and submit feedback. 

Why Build an On-Demand Video Streaming App Like HBO Max

On-demand video streaming apps offer businesses a gateway to become a part of the rapidly growing media and entertainment industry. Here are some compelling reasons to invest in building an on-demand streaming app like HBO Max. 

#1 The Demand for Streaming Content is Exploding

With the shift in consumer preferences, from traditional satellite television to online streaming, the demand for OTT content is skyrocketing. Such platforms ot only provide convenience but also offer users the flexibility to watch any content at any time. By developing an online streaming app like HBO Max, you can grab this opportunity and reach out to global audiences. 

#2 To Generate High Revenue 

An app like HBO Max offers the flexibility to implement different subscription models and generate high and recurring revenue. You can choose from subscription models, AVOD (Advertising Video On Demand, TVOD (Transactional Video On Demand), Merchandising, and Partnerships. 

#3 To Ensure Content Ownership 

With an HBO Max-like video streaming app development, you can ensure complete content ownership, establish a positive brand identity, and ensure data-driven personalization and content curation to enhance user engagement.   

#4 To Get a Competitive Edge 

On-demand video streaming apps are trending, their user base is growing multifold every year. This gives you an opportunity to create a large market share and generate revenue or profitability. You can plan to invest in original and high-quality content to stand out among your competitors. 

#5 To Establish a Direct-to-Consumer Relationship

When you develop a video streaming application like HBO Max, you can eliminate middlemen. Content creators and distributors can directly connect with consumers, get their valuable feedback, and establish a sense of community, which is important for any business’s success. 

You may like: How to Develop an AI-Based Entertainment App

Benefits of Developing a Video Streaming App Similar to HBO Max

Now that you know all the compelling reasons why to invest in a video streaming app similar to HBO Max, let’s check out the benefits you will get with it:

#1 Revenue Generation with Multiple Monetization Models

The ultimate goal of any application, including a video streaming app like HBO Max, is to generate high revenue. An app like HBO Max enables you to implement different monetization models, like subscription models, where you can charge for premium content and services. 

Other ways you can choose to generate money out of your live streaming app are by embedding in-app advertisements, offering premium content like new movie releases or live events for individual purchase or rental, and through in-app purchases. 

#2 Brand Building and Recognition 

A properly designed and feature-rich video streaming app helps you establish a strong foothold in the market by delivering high-quality entertainment. With it, you can reach global audiences and enhance brand recognition. 

#3 Data and User Insights

When you build an online video streaming app like HBO Max using artificial intelligence and related technologies, you can get crucial insights on user preferences, viewing habits, and demographics. This data can be further used to personalize content recommendations, optimize marketing strategies, and ensure exceptional customer experiences. 

You can even optimize content by identifying popular content trends. This would help you increase content views and your app’s popularity. 

#4 Global Reach

By creating an HBO Max-like video streaming app, you can expand your reach and content distribution to attract international subscribers. Moreover, if your app is cross-platform, you can provide users with the flexibility and convenience to access content from smartphones, tablets, smart TVs, and web browsers, which will increase their experience. 

#5 Enhanced User Engagement 

Developing a video streaming app like HBO Max using AI and other technologies offers numerous ways to enhance user engagement. You can deliver personalized content recommendations, add interactive features like social sharing, watch parties, and offline viewing, to improve user engagement and retention. 

Technology Stack for an HBO Max-Like Video Streaming App Development

Choosing the right technology stack depends on your specific app requirements. However, here is the list of the technologies you can choose from:

Front-End Development For Mobile Apps- React Native, Flutter, or native iOS/Android development 
For Web Apps- React, Angular, or Vue.js 
Back-End DevelopmentNode.js, Python (Django/Flask), or Java (Spring Boot) for server-side logic
Cloud platforms like AWS, Google Cloud, or Azure for scalability and reliability
DatabaseMySQL, PostgreSQL, or MongoDB
Video StreamingMedia Servers– Wowza or Red5
Content Delivery Networks (CDNs)- Akamai or CloudflaAkamai or Cloudfla
Video Encoding and Decoding- FFMPEG
DRM or Digital Rights Management- Widevine, FairPlay, PlayReady
Payment Gateway IntegrationStripe, PayPal, or Braintree

Features to Add While Developing a Video Streaming App Similar to HBO Max

With the market inundated with many video streaming platforms (Netflix, Hulu, HBO Max, Amazon Prime, and more), it is quite challenging to build a new one that immediately gains users’ attention and maximizes revenue. 

To build a successful video streaming platform akin to HBO Max, include core features like user registration, profile management, content library, search, filters, HD video playback, multi-device compatibility, and offline viewing. On the other hand, if you want to make your app stand out from the competition, it is recommended to add additional features using AI, ML, Blockchain, Generative AI, and other such technologies. Use modern technologies to add the following features to your app:

  • Offline Downloads
  • 4K/HDR Support
  • Multiple User Profiles
  • Parental Controls
  • Live Streaming
  • Social Viewing/Watch Party
  • Content Discovery and Curation
  • Generative AI-powered Search
  • AI-Powered Content Recommendations

You may like to read: Generative AI in the OTT Industry: How It Will Impact the OTT Revolution

Monetization Models for an HBO-like Mobile Application

Investing in an app like HBO Max app development? Here is how you can make money from it.  

#1 Subscription Video on Demand (SVOD)

With this model, you can generate revenue from a recurring fee. Users can subscribe to your app with a monthly or annual subscription to access unlimited content from the library. They can even access premium features of your app. 

#2 Advertising Video on Demand (AVOD)

The second monetization model that you can choose is AVOD. In this, you can offer free content to users while generating revenue through advertisements. The best example of this model is YouTube. It shows videos for free while displaying ads in between to earn money. 

#3 Transactional Video on Demand (TVOD) 

With this monetization model, users can pay for individual content by renting or purchasing new releases before they are available to other users. This would provide them access to new content, while you can generate huge revenue. 

#4 Hybrid Models 

For your video streaming mobile app like HBO, you can choose to implement a hybrid monetization model, where you can offer a basic ad-supported tier and a premium ad-free subscription to choose from.

While we have provided you with the most common models, it is crucial to consider factors like target audience, content library, market competition, and user experience to pick the right model that doesn’t impact user experience and generates high revenue for your business. 

Also Read: Top Android App Monetization Strategies: Freemium vs. Paid Apps

Build a Successful Online Video Streaming App with Quytech

Quytech is your reliable technology partner and a trusted video streaming app development company that global startups and businesses trust to build future-ready OTT platforms and video streaming apps like HBO Max. The company has prior experience in transforming the media and entertainment industry by developing customized, scalable, and secure video streaming apps using technologies like artificial intelligence, blockchain, generative AI, and other emerging technologies. 

Final Thoughts 

These days, video streaming apps and platforms like HBO Max are the most common and popular source of entertainment that users choose to access content. These platforms have shifted the majority of audiences from traditional TVs to OTT platforms. 

If you want to build one, this blog is exclusively for you. It covers everything, including a stepwise process to OTT platform development or HBO Max-like app development, benefits, key features to include, monetization models, and technology stack you can use. On the other hand, if you don’t want to build such an app on your own, connect with a reliable OTT platform development company like Quytech. Share your exact requirements to get exactly what you want.  

Frequently Asked Questions

Q 01- How much does it cost to build a video streaming app like HBO Max?

The cost to create a video streamlining app similar to HBO Max can be determined by taking into account different factors such as the size and complexity of the app, technologies, target market laws and regulations, and more. For an accurate estimation, connect with a reputed Video Streaming App Development or OTT platform development company. 

Q 02- How long does it take to create a video streaming app similar to HBO Max?

The time required to develop a video streaming app such as HBO Max depends on various factors, including the size and complexity, the technology stack required for the development, and the features to be added. 
For a basic app with limited features, it may take 3 to 4 months; on the other hand, for an advanced-level video streaming app development, it may take up to a year. 

Q 03- How does a video streaming platform like HBO Max work?

Here is how OTT platforms like HBO Max work to deliver content to global audiences:
– A user creates an account and selects their preferred language and interests by choosing from the displayed categories.
– Once logged in, they can either personalize their profiles or simply begin searching the content (movies, web series, TV shows, etc.) of their choice. 
– The user can also download the content to watch later or offline.
– They can also create a personalized list to add content. 
– The platform also provides users with an option to rate, review, and share the content. 

Q 04- How to make money from video streaming mobile applications?

There are several ways to make money from video streaming mobile apps like HBO Max. It can be through subscription fees, advertising, freemium, and pay-per-view. 

Q 05- What are the challenges associated with developing a video streaming app like HBO Max?

While building an online streaming app like HBO Max, you may encounter challenges related to content licensing and acquisition, technical infrastructure, scalability, user experience, development cost, marketing and user acquisition, and data collection and utilization.